Since, Rosie has embarked on several business ventures including her own beauty line Rose Inc and a hugely successful collaboration with Wardrobe. NYC.
In another major life change, Rosie and her Hollywood star partner Jason, 57, recently moved back to London for the safety of their children.
After living in California for 11 years, Rosie and Jason have invested 15million in three luxury homes in London.
Speaking to the Telegraph in October, Rosie said the experience had been ‘grounding’.
She said: ‘Living back in the UK has been a really grounding experience for us.

‘The fact that we can walk out of our front door and go and get a coffee and a loaf of bread [without paparazzi intrusion].
‘We’d leave our home in LA and there’d be five cars following us down the block to the gym. Both Jason and I felt like it was really important for our children to not be impacted by our line of work.
‘We wanted our kids to have a childhood away from cameras as much as we could. Because I’ve seen that.
‘I’ve seen children of celebrities whose parents didn’t give them that choice. It’s Jack’s choice and it’s Bella’s choice, whether they live in the public eye.
‘If they want to, that won’t be a problem. But I just always feared my son turning round to me one day and saying, ‘You and Daddy didn’t protect me, I don’t want this’.’
She and Jason first began dating in 2009 after meeting at a party in London and experiencing what Rosie called ‘instant chemistry’.
They made their red carpet debut in February 2011 at the Vanity Fair Oscars after party, and later that year attended the Met Gala together as well.
They became engaged in 2016, and have a son Jack, seven, and daughter Isabella, two.
Speaking about their plans to marry after Jack was born, Rosie said: ‘I think the time will come. It’s also not a huge priority for us.’
She has also addressed the couple’s 20-year age gap, saying: ‘His knowledge and strength are really inspiring and attractive, and that can come with a man who’s had a bit of time.’
